Abstract
Pituitary carcinoma (PC) is extremely rare, with its incidence only accounting for 0.1%-0.2% of pituitary tumor (PT). Existing histological features, including invasiveness, cellular pleomorphism, nuclear atypia, mitosis, necrosis, etc., can be observed in pituitary adenoma (PA), invasive PA (IPA) and PC. Invasion is not the basis for the diagnosis of PC. The diagnosis of PC is often determined after the metastases are found, hence early diagnosis is extraordinarily difficult. Owing to the conventional treatment for PC may not be effective, a large portion of patients survived less than one year after diagnosis. Therefore, it is of great significance to find an efficacious treatment for PC. We report a rare case of sparsely granulated somatotroph carcinoma with cerebrospinal fluid dissemination showing a favorable treatment response to temozolomide (TMZ) combined with whole-brain and spinal cord radiotherapy.

Abstract
OBJECTIVE Pituitary carcinoma is a rare tumor, defined as a tumor of adenohypophyseal cells with systemic or craniospinal metastasis. We present a case of a growth hormone (GH)-secreting pituitary carcinoma with a review of literature to better characterize this disease. DESIGN Case report and literature review of 25 cases of GH-secreting pituitary carcinomas RESULTS: The age of diagnosis of GH-secreting carcinomas ranged 24-69 years old with a mean age of 44.4 with 52% of cases present in females. Mean latency period between diagnosis of acromegaly and transition to pituitary carcinoma was 11.4 years with mean survival being 3.4 years. CONCLUSION Growth hormone (GH)-secreting pituitary carcinomas are rare and hard to distinguish from aggressive pituitary adenomas. From review of literature, treatment options include debulking surgery, radiotherapy, or chemotherapy with dismal outcomes. There are no diagnostic markers or features which can predict metastatic progression of these tumors. Future studies with genomic landscapes and relevant tumor markers are needed to identify pituitary tumors most likely to metastasize.

Abstract
BACKGROUND Pituitary carcinoma is defined by either metastases outside the central nervous system or noncontiguous foci within the central nervous system. This case report details the first documented case of a pathologically isolated follicle-stimulating hormone-secreting pituitary carcinoma and its presentation of metastasis. CASE DESCRIPTION A 63-year-old man developed intrascapular pain radiating up his neck to his occiput. He had undergone a transsphenoidal hypophysectomy 2 years previously for an atypical pituitary macroadenoma. Subsequent magnetic resonance imaging identified a focal, solitary, well-circumscribed, homogeneous T2 high-signal intradural, extramedullary enhancing mass at C2-3 in a right ventral parasagittal location, extending toward the exit foramina. On surgical excision with a laminectomy, the mass demonstrated a morphologic appearance of a malignant neuroendocrine tumor with an immunoprofile similar to the original atypical pituitary adenoma. This was in keeping with metastatic disease secondary to a follicle-stimulating hormone-secreting pituitary carcinoma. CONCLUSIONS Although rare, metastatic spread is recognized in patients with atypical pituitary adenoma. This should form the differential diagnosis for such patients presenting with symptoms that could be attributed to metastatic lesions within the neuraxis. In these patients, who undergo regular surveillance in joint neuroendocrine clinics, more urgent investigation of new spinal pain should be instigated to exclude metastatic disease.

Abstract
Background: Although pituitary adenoma is one of the most common intracranial tumors, it rarely progresses secondarily into a metastatic carcinoma. Commonalities in reported cases include subtotal resection at presentation, treatment with radiation therapy, and delayed metastatic progression. Pathologic descriptions of these lesions are varying and inconsistent. Case Description: A 52-year-old male was diagnosed with acromegaly and pituitary tumor in 1996. He underwent four subtotal resections and five courses of stereotactic radiosurgery over 14 years. He developed left eye lateral gaze palsy, and was found to have a distant orbital metastasis with involvement of the left lateral rectus and lateral orbital wall. He underwent left orbital craniotomy via eyebrow incision for resection of this lesion. Pathologic evaluation showed a markedly elevated Ki67 level of 30%. Conclusion: While overall incidence of metastatic progression of pituitary adenoma after radiotherapy appears to be low, it appears to be a possible complication, and could be more likely in patients receiving multiple doses of radiotherapy. Our review of reported cases showed that 45/46 (97.8%) of patients developing carcinoma had prior radiation exposure. These patients may also have more aggressive pathologic characteristics of their lesions.

Abstract
CONTEXT Although pituitary tumors are common, pituitary carcinoma is very rare and is only diagnosed when pituitary tumor noncontiguous with the sellar region is demonstrated. Diagnosis is difficult, resulting in delays that may adversely effect outcome that is traditionally poor. Barriers to earlier diagnosis and management strategies for pituitary carcinoma are discussed. EVIDENCE ACQUISITION PubMed was employed to identify relevant studies, a review of the literature was conducted, and data were summarized and integrated from the author's perspective. EVIDENCE SYNTHESIS The available data highlight the difficulties in diagnosis and management and practical challenges in conducting clinical trials in this rare condition. They suggest that earlier diagnosis with aggressive multimodal therapy may be advantageous in some cases. CONCLUSIONS Although pituitary carcinoma remains difficult to diagnose and treat, recent developments have led to improved outcomes in selected cases. With broader use of molecular markers, efforts to modify current histopathological criteria for pituitary carcinoma diagnosis may now be possible. This would assist earlier diagnosis and, in combination with targeted therapies, potentially improve long-term survival.

Abstract
Background Pituitary carcinomas are rare neuroendocrine tumors affecting the adenohypophysis. The hallmark of these lesions is the demonstration of distant metastatic spread. To date, few well-documented cases have been reported in the literature. Case presentation Here, we report the case of a fatal pituitary carcinoma evolving within two years from an adrenocorticotrophic hormone (ACTH)-secreting macroadenoma and review the global literature regarding this rare neuroendocrine tumor. Conclusion Pituitary carcinomas are extremely rare neoplasms, representing only 0.1% to 0.2% of all pituitary tumors. To date, little is understood about the molecular basis of malignant transformation. The latency period between initial presentation of a pituitary adenoma and the development of distal metastases marking carcinoma is extremely variable, and some patients may live well over 10 years with pituitary carcinoma.
